The Spanish pilot Carlos Sainz, currently at Ferrari, admitted this Thursday that the rumor circulating in the world of Formula 1 “makes him laugh” about his possible signing for Williamspointing out that “nothing is closed” still about his future in the World Championship.

“No, the only thing I can tell you is that nothing is closed”said Sainz from Montreal when asked by the specialized media. ‘The Race’. “I have seen news in the media, I don’t know if in Spain, and people saying that I have signed [por Williams]. “If you look at those things, it makes me laugh because I remember seeing news three months ago that he had signed for Mercedes and that he had signed for Red Bull.”he answered.

Now, obviously, those scenarios are not going to happen. So it’s funny that now people say I signed for Williams. He makes me laugh, but sometimes this goes a bit unpunished by some media outlets. And I’m not referring to you because you are very involved in Formula 1 and you know when something has been signed or not,” Sainz added.
After not answering a specific question about WilliamsSainz described how “good options” what you have received for Negotiate and he congratulated himself for being able to choose. “I have felt loved by everyone I have spoken to. I have felt that people really want me on their team and this makes me feel proud and positive about the future”concluded the Madrid native from the Gilles Villeneuve Circuit.
